Output 66d21bf5f6cc7b79278f3cbceca851f55859a436dca3d9deb745adb057f4109b:0

value
671113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c366cee57a3ae097e3aba915f77111a481073a4 OP_EQUAL
address
35inrXzVWBM3NZ8rAwfiVs74rJfJtadQvd
transaction
66d21bf5f6cc7b79278f3cbceca851f55859a436dca3d9deb745adb057f4109b
confirmations
257927
spent
true